1. GENERAL INFORMATION 1.1. Application The PRO 52-MT2 is a drilling machine designed to drill holes with diameters of up to 52 mm by using annular cutters. The machine can also drill holes with diameters of up to 23 mm by using twist drill bits. It also allows machining holes with diameters of up to 55 mm by using countersinks.

HMPRO52-MT2 OPERATOR’S MANUAL PRO-50 To remove the arbor (twist drill bit or countersink), continue in the sequence that follows. Lift the motor and turn the spindle (1) so that the holes in the spindle and gearbox align (2). Put the drift into the hole (3). Next, hold the carrying handle with one hand and hit the drift with a mallet (4).

HMPRO52-MT2 OPERATOR’S MANUAL PRO-50 3.5. Monitoring system of the clamping force The drilling machine has a system that monitors the clamping force of the electro- magnetic base. The force will be lower if there is rust, paint, chips, or dirt. The force will be lower also if the surface is thin, rough, not flat, not rigid, the voltage is lower than required, or the bottom of the base is worn.

HMPRO52-MT2 OPERATOR’S MANUAL PRO-50 3.9. Replacing the brushes Every 100 work hours, check the condition of the brushes. To do this, unplug the power cord and remove the cover (1). Lift the spring (2) and remove the brush. If the brush is shorter than 5 mm (0.2″), replace the two brushes with new ones.
